UNC Defensive Back Will Hardy Ditches Eyesore in Return to Health
Posted Aug 15, 2024
During his time at UNC, the yellow non-contact practice jersey has become an unwanted sight for defensive back Will Hardy. Hardy wore one in the Tar Heels' spring football game in 2023 and during all of training camp last year, after suffering a hamstring injury. But now Hardy is healthy, which means he isn't relegated to the yellow eyesore anymore.
